
TCU to Host Notre Dame
7/16/2025 11:00:00 AM | Men's Basketball
The Horned Frogs will visit South Bend in 2026
FORT WORTH – TCU will host another Power 4 team in nonconference play this season when Notre Dame visits Schollmaier Arena on Friday, Dec. 5, 2025.
It will be the second time ever and the first time since Jan. 13, 1980 that the Fighting Irish will play in Fort Worth. Notre Dame leads the all-time series 5-0 with the last meeting coming on March 18, 1997, in South Bend, Ind. TCU will then play at Notre Dame on Dec. 5, 2026.
The history in the series is tied to TCU's head coach. Jamie Dixon's 1987 Southwest Conference Championship team lost a one-point game to Notre Dame, 58-57, in the second round of the NCAA Tournament in Charlotte, N.C.
The game will take place less than a month after TCU hosts possible preseason top 10 Michigan on Friday, Nov. 14. Other 2025 NCAA Tournament teams TCU will face this season are Arizona, Baylor, BYU, Houston, Iowa State, Kansas and Texas Tech.
